Using a lever, a person applies 60 newtons of force and moves the lever 1 meter. This moves a 200N rock at the other end by 0.2 meters. Work Output? Work Input? Efficiency?

Respuesta :

ANSWER:

Work Output = 40 N*m

Work Input = 60 N*m

Efficiency = 66.67%
